cienaCesGmplsDynamicIngressCoroutedTunnelDestIpAddr

Module: CIENA-CES-MPLS-MIB

OID (symbolic): CIENA-CES-MPLS-MIB::cienaCesGmplsDynamicIngressCoroutedTunnelDestIpAddr

OID (numeric): 1.3.6.1.4.1.1271.2.1.18.1.2.4.1.5

Node type: OBJECT-TYPE

Type: IpAddress

Access: read-only

Description: Destination IP address of the Dynamic encap tunnel. If not specified, the Dynamic encap tunnel inherits the IP address of the tunnel-group. This object cannot be modified once the Dynamic encap tunnel entry is created.

What is cienaCesGmplsDynamicIngressCoroutedTunnelDestIpAddr?

This is the destination IP address this dynamically-signaled co-routed tunnel targets, inheriting the tunnel-group's address if unspecified and immutable once created, remaining the fixed endpoint for the bidirectional circuit regardless of path changes. An admin relies on this staying constant as the anchor for both directions of the circuit even as RSVP-TE varies the actual route taken to reach it. For example, this destination staying at 10.120.0.9 across re-signaling events confirms the circuit always converges on the intended remote endpoint.

Examples

Walk all instances (SNMPv2c):

snmpwalk -v2c -c public <target> 1.3.6.1.4.1.1271.2.1.18.1.2.4.1.5
snmpwalk -v2c -c public <target> CIENA-CES-MPLS-MIB::cienaCesGmplsDynamicIngressCoroutedTunnelDestIpAddr

Get a specific instance (index 1):

snmpget -v2c -c public <target> 1.3.6.1.4.1.1271.2.1.18.1.2.4.1.5.1
snmpget -v2c -c public <target> CIENA-CES-MPLS-MIB::cienaCesGmplsDynamicIngressCoroutedTunnelDestIpAddr.1
